抄録: | The change of internal stress in the electrodeposited PbC₂ from a lead nitrate bath was observed by measuring the deflection of a thin platinum anode during electrodeposition of PbC₂ on one side of it. The crystal structure of the deposits was determined by X-ray diffraction. After the electrodeposition, the change of deflection of the deposited Pb₂ was observed under the following conditions : a) Keep the deposited PbO₂ in air or in a lead nitrate bath at constant temperatures. b) Discharge the cell, Pt/PbNO₃ electrolyte/PbO₂ deposit, by connecting it to an external circuit with some resistance. The results obtained are summarized as follows : 1) The crystal structure of α-PbO₂ was observed in the deposits which had deflected in the direction of contraction during electrodeposition, and β-PbO₂ was observed in the deposits which had deflected in the direction of expansion during electrodeposition. 2) After the electrodeposition, the deposits deflected gradually in the direction of expansion when they were kept in air or left in the bath. The amount of deflection of the deposits of α-PbO₂ was larger than that of the deposits of β-PbO₂ within the same time duration. 3) The electrodeposited PbO₂ deflected in the direction of expansion by discharging the cell, and the amount of deflection of the deposits of α-PbO₂ was larger than that of the deposits of β-PbO₂. |
